Bunk beds come in a wide array of styles dealing with different tastes and requirements. Here are some popular designs found in the UK market:
Design Type | Description |
---|---|
Conventional Wooden | Classic style; offered in numerous surfaces; tough and classic. |
Metal Bunk Beds | Lightweight, typically with a contemporary or commercial look; easy to move. |
Loft Beds | Raised beds that supply below space for desks, storage, or play. |
Futon Bunk Beds | A combination of a futon and bunk bed; ideal for multi-purpose spaces. |
L-Shaped Bunk Beds | 2 beds positioned in an L-shape; great for making the most of corner areas. |

Q1: What age appropriates for kids to oversleep bunk beds?A1: Most
experts advise that kids under the age of 6 ought to not sleep on the leading bunk due to safety issues regarding falls.
Q2: Can bunk beds fit in any space size?A2: While bunk beds
are developed to conserve space, they still need adequate ceiling height for safety. Normally, a room ought to have at least 7.5 to 8 feet of ceiling height. Q3: Are bunk beds safe for toddlers?A3: While some bunk beds are created particularly for young children,
the majority of specialists suggest that kids under the age of six should use the bottom bunk for safety. Q4: How do I clean up a bunk bed?A4: Regular cleaning can be done using a wet cloth for the wooden or
metal surfaces. Mattresses need to
be vacuumed and cleaned up according to maker guidelines. 7.
